The Yellow River is diverted:
In the second year of Jianyan in the Southern Song Dynasty (1128 AD), in order to resist the Jin army's southward advance, Du Chong, left behind in Tokyo, opened the Yellow River embankment in Huazhou, causing the Yellow River to divert its route, and went southeast from Sishui and Ji River to the sea.
At this point, the Yellow River enters the Bohai Sea from the north to the Yellow Sea from the south to the Yellow Sea.
Before 1855, the Yellow River mainly swung in the south. Although it was swept north at times, it was forced to block the south by human forces.
During the period when the south flowed south to capture the Huai River and above the Qingkou River, the main stream of the Yellow River below Zhengzhou and above the Qingkou also migrated uncertainly, either from the Si River, from the Bian River and the Wo River to the Huai River, or from the Ying River to the Huai River, or from the Ying River to the Huai River at the same time. It was not until the late Ming Dynasty that Pan Jixu ruled the river that the Yellow River was basically fixed in Kaifeng, Lankao, Shangqiu, Dangshan, Xuzhou, Suqian, and Huaiyin. It is the former path of the Ming and Qing Dynasties, and it has been running for 300 years.
In the fifth year of Xianfeng in the Qing Dynasty (1855), the Yellow River broke the copper tile wing in Lanyang, Henan (now Lankao County), and diverted it. It was once again placed back to the north, passing through the current river channel, and flowing into the Bohai Sea in the north.
